🇭🇺 Hungary's public holidays in 2026 at a glance
Hungary has 16 nationwide public holidays in 2026. That puts Hungary joint 19th out of the 100 countries we track, level with 7 others. The median across those 100 is 13. 11 fall on a weekday and 5 on a Saturday or Sunday. The year opens with New Year's Day on 1 January and closes with Second Day of Christmas on 26 December. April is the busiest month with 3. Nothing at all falls in February, June, July or September. This list covers holidays observed across the whole country. Many countries add regional or state holidays on top, and whether a given day is paid depends on your employer, so check locally before you book around it.
Hungary public holidays in January 2026
New Year's Day (Újév) on 1 January and Day off (substituted from 01/10/2026) (Pihenőnap (2026. 01. 10.-től helyettesítve)) on 2 January.
Hungary public holidays in February 2026
There are no public holidays in Hungary in February 2026.
Hungary public holidays in March 2026
National Day (Nemzeti ünnep) on 15 March.
Hungary public holidays in April 2026
Good Friday (Nagypéntek) on 3 April, Easter (Húsvét) on 5 April and Easter Monday (Húsvét Hétfő) on 6 April.
Hungary public holidays in May 2026
Labor Day (A Munka ünnepe) on 1 May, Pentecost (Pünkösd) on 24 May and Pentecost Monday (Pünkösdhétfő) on 25 May.
Hungary public holidays in June 2026
There are no public holidays in Hungary in June 2026.
Hungary public holidays in July 2026
There are no public holidays in Hungary in July 2026.
Hungary public holidays in August 2026
State Foundation Day (Az államalapítás ünnepe) on 20 August and Day off (substituted from 08/08/2026) (Pihenőnap (2026. 08. 08.-től helyettesítve)) on 21 August.
Hungary public holidays in September 2026
There are no public holidays in Hungary in September 2026.
Hungary public holidays in October 2026
National Day (Nemzeti ünnep) on 23 October.
Hungary public holidays in November 2026
All Saints' Day (Mindenszentek) on 1 November.
Hungary public holidays in December 2026
Day off (substituted from 12/12/2026) (Pihenőnap (2026. 12. 12.-től helyettesítve)) on 24 December, Christmas Day (Karácsony) on 25 December and Second Day of Christmas (Karácsony másnapja) on 26 December.

Which Hungary holidays create a long weekend in 2026?
Good Friday (Friday, 3 April), Easter and Easter Monday (5 April–6 April), Labor Day (Friday, 1 May), Pentecost and Pentecost Monday (24 May–25 May) and National Day (Friday, 23 October) fall on a Friday or a Monday, so the weekend beside them runs to three days without using any leave.
Do businesses close on public holidays in Hungary?
Banks, government offices and schools generally close on national public holidays in Hungary, while shops, restaurants and transport often run reduced hours rather than shutting entirely.
